Beginner Drop Spindle Class

Curious how clothes were made before machines were invented? Come learn how to spin wool into yarn. You will learn the history of spinning, how to draft wool, and discuss how to set the twist in your small skein of yarn when you get home. Recommended for ages middle school to adult.
